How we calculate this

Solar generation: Based on typical south-facing roof at 35° angle. We account for weather, dirt, and system losses (14%).

How much you'll use directly:

  • Without battery: You'll use about 40% of what you generate. The rest gets sold back to the grid.
  • With 5 kWh battery: You'll use about 70% (battery stores extra for evening use).
  • With 10 kWh battery: You'll use about 75% (more storage means less exported).
  • Panel-only payback: Bigger systems don’t shorten payback—cost and savings rise together per kW.
  • Battery & payback: Batteries raise self-use and cut bills, but added hardware cost often lengthens break-even at typical UK rates.
  • When a battery can still make sense:
    • Evening-heavy usage patterns
    • Time-of-use tariffs / cheap night rates
    • Low export rate vs. high unit rate
    • Heat pump or EV charging synergy
    • Optional backup/resilience (system-dependent)
    • Lower evening-hour CO₂ vs. grid

Costs: Battery prices are typically £700 per kWh. Export tariffs vary by supplier (usually 5–15p per kWh).

Grid connection: Systems up to about 3.7 kW typically need just a notification (G98). Larger systems may need permission (G99).

These are typical values based on average usage patterns. Your actual results will vary based on your roof, shading, and how you use electricity.

A typical roof here lands around 5.0 kW, with most eligible homes comfortably fitting within 3–6 kW. Each kilowatt of panels produces roughly 962 kWh per year on a south-facing roof. We value self-used electricity at 25.6p and exported surplus at a baseline 10p via SEG. Use the calculator above for your exact tariff.
